sorry hosp
i was in a very similar situation 2 years ago, i am a programmer and only worked about 5 months that year, for 3 different employers.
Employers love certifications, i studied and got 2 (mcad and mcsd) and that made all the difference, after i finished studying, i re-applied for jobs, got 3 job interviews for the 3 jobs i applied for in the first week and got offered 2 jobs out of those 3. prior to this i was getting interviews for about 20% of jobs i applied for and was getting alot of "you are our second choice" feedback.
certification does not improve your knowledge, but the person making the employee decisions usually has limited technical ability and always picks the safe option i.e. person with the cert. additionally you are viewed as far more indispensable in the workplace
best of luck, here a few more tips that got me through a very bad time
1.) do not take it personally, IT is the wrong industry at its worst time
2.) treat the application process like a job
3.) never pin your hopes on one job or one recruitment consultant
